For the Imperial City house, go to the market district in the Imperial City. Find the Office of Commerce, and talk to the lady behind the counter. You may have to raise her disposition in the speechcraft minigame to get her to sell you the house. After getting the deed, go to the Three Brothers Trade Shop and talk to one of the brothers. One of them will sell you furniture for the house. The house is located in the Imperial City waterfront, and should cost about 4000 Gold or so for the deed plus all the furniture. It isn't a pretty or big house, but it will suffice. Store all of the valuables you don't need in the chest there, it won't reset.

@Redneck - you have to get your Agility restored.

You can buy a "Restore Agility" spell - I think there is someone who sells it in the Chapel in Bruma

- or you can buy any spell that has a restore attribute effect, and then you can make your own "Restore Agililty" spell (if you have access to the spellmaking altar in the Arcane University or Frostcraig Spire)

- or you can make a potion of Restore Agility

The following alchemy ingredients can be used to create potions of Restore Agility

Arrowroot
Aster Bloom CoreSI
Cinnabar Polypore Red Cap
Emetic Russula Cap
Fly Amanita Cap
Summer Bolete Cap

- also, you might want to consider just roleplaying a character who has a curse on his Agility for a while. makes him a little bit clumsy and not as good at Archery

sympathy4saren wrote...
Would it be lame if I named my Skyrim character Sauron?

Yes.

But to be fair I'm incredibly pedantic when it comes to naming characters and believe the names must follow the established lore.

Imperial = Roman names
Breton = French names
Bosmer = Welsh names with no last name
Orcs = X gro-Y (if male) X gra-Y (if female)
Khajiit = Arabic sounding name with an already established prefix at the start (J', Dar, Do, Dro, Ra, S' etc). A suffix may be added but that means other khajiit would see you as arrogant/foolish.

etc

If a character's name does not follow these conventions their name should at least come from the names of one of the other races and there needs to be sufficient backstory as to why they have it.
